Standing Beauty by Kondo Katsunobu depicts a woman standing and wearing a traditional Japanese kimono. The kimono is primarily black with a white lining visible at the sleeves and hem. It has a striped pattern on the sleeves and torso area, with predominantly orange, blue, and red stripes. The woman's hair is pulled back into a bun. She is standing on a beige background, and the painting has an orange border with a floral pattern. The woman's face is white and smooth, and she appears to be looking to her left. There is a signature in Japanese characters on the bottom right side of the painting.
